Ingredients for Low Fat Peanut Butter's More Bars

  • 1 (19.8 ounce) box brownie mix
  • 1 cup egg substitute
  • 1/2 cup non-fat vanilla yogurt
  • 1/4 cup water
  • 1 (14.4 ounce) box low-fat graham crackers
  • 1 cup mini marshmallows
  • 1/2 cup peanut butter chips and 1/2 cup milk chocolate chips

How to Make Low Fat Peanut Butter's More Bars

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ly grease a 9x13 inch baking dish.
  2. Arrange a layer of whole graham crackers across the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
  3. Break remaining graham crackers into smaller pieces to create a full, even layer on top of the whole crackers.
  4. In a large bowl, prepare your brownie mix according to package directions, substituting the required amount of egg substitute for the eggs and 1/2 cup of vanilla yogurt for the oil. (Check your brownie mix box for exact substitution amounts)
  5. Pour the brownie batter evenly over the graham cracker layer.
  6. Bake for 25-28 minutes, or until the brownie edges are set and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out with moist crumbs.
  7. Remove from oven. Do not turn off the oven.
  8. Evenly distribute mini marshmallows (1 cup) and 1/2 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ips over the warm brownies.
  9. Return to the oven for 3-4 minutes, or until marshmallows are golden brown and puffy, and the chocolate chips are melted.
  10. Remove from oven and let cool for 2 minutes. Using a knife or spatula, gently spread the melted marshmallows and chocolate to create an even top layer.
  11. Let cool completely before using a wet knife to cut into bars. Serve and enjoy!
  12. Store bars in a single layer in an airtight container at room temperature. Do not stack.
